Olly Alexander has finally addressed the rumours he’s set to star in Doctor Who. The Years & Years singer got a taste for acting in the critically acclaimed series It’s A Sin and it was recently reported he’s a favourite to replace Jodie Whittaker in BBC One’s long-running hit.
Speaking to Metro.co.uk about the rumours at the MTV EMAs 2021 on Sunday, the singer said: ‘I was so flattered and inspired by that but I’m definitely not the next Doctor Who.
It’s an amazing show and I was quite flattered that people thought I might be able to do it.’ While we wait to find out if Olly will become the next Doctor, fans can see him on screens much sooner as he’ll be appearing in the Great British Bake Off Christmas special this December.
